Transaction 4218b413d6d7426dcbf14ede5772d8614d81d30bfcb84a2d9158888763d39949

block
57d6ef4a6d95ae5d8dcaa34d7b62e5b112c4fa38eb2836dd3bc1f5826152ede1

1 Input

61 Outputs